Output 2bb21351bc6d75ffba0a73ae8b3aa26286006a8289900688d8b845de06760efe:80

value
872485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f63069f554b644488751f3926f9fc96435251b4 OP_EQUAL
address
361aJzpjcfJ9588bXuUWpASQ4bZpCCq9bh
transaction
2bb21351bc6d75ffba0a73ae8b3aa26286006a8289900688d8b845de06760efe
confirmations
224570
spent
true